Skills:
Launching and Configuring Cloud Machines: Deploy new machines in the cloud for client applications,
ensuring proper configuration and setup
Utilizing AWS Services: Create and manage services using AWS services such as EC2 instances,
Auto Scaling, S3, Elastic Load Balancers, AMIs, and snapshots by utilizing EBS
Database Management: Set up and manage databases on Amazon RDS, ensuring proper
performance and availability. Monitor servers using Amazon CloudWatch
Virtual Private Cloud Setup: Configure Virtual Private Cloud (VPC) with different subnets, routing
tables (RT), Internet Gateways (IGW), and NAT Gateways
Server Monitoring and Alerts: Monitor servers using Amazon CloudWatch and set up monitoring
alerts based on severity levels
Scripting Automation: Develop and write scripts using Shell and Python to automate workflows and
streamline processes
Containerization and Docker: Utilize Docker to containerize applications and manage containerized
environments, ensuring scalability and portability
Infrastructure Optimization: Implement and optimize infrastructure using Elastic Container
Service (ECS) to enhance performance and efficiency
Static and Docker Application Deployment: Deploy static applications using CloudFront and S3.
Deploy Docker applications effectively